Output 085bebe17ee55d6da79f156d8ced6220d03dfb7034e53d4fd64ef743ccaa9d38:1

value
438323
script pubkey
OP_0 OP_PUSHBYTES_20 2c16de66e6e5cf5843de31a33efc1e40e7282e77
address
bc1q9stduehxuh84ss77xx3nalq7grnjstnhtljn2s
transaction
085bebe17ee55d6da79f156d8ced6220d03dfb7034e53d4fd64ef743ccaa9d38
confirmations
179470
spent
true